Cast announced for Dad’s Army movie remake

Facebooktwittergoogle_plusredditpinterestlinkedintumblrmailFacebooktwittergoogle_plusredditpinterestlinkedintumblrmail 0

Fans of the hit British TV series, Dad’s Army, rejoice; the cast has been revealed today for the film remake – which will be shot entirely in Yorkshire – and it’s already shaping up to be an incredible ensemble. An impressive troupe of veterans will play the old-age military men, including Bill Nighy as Wilson, followed by Toby Jones as Captain Mainwaring, and Michael Gambon as Godfrey. A fresher face joining them will be The Inbetweeners’ Blake Harrison as Pike, while Catherine Zeta-Jones will play a journalist sent to Walmington-on-Sea. It’ll be interesting to see how the 21st Century reacts to a Dad’s Army film, but with a cast like that, we’re sure it’ll do just fine at the box office.
